When do we need multiple Dispatcher Servlet?


In which scenarios, we need multiple Dispatcher Servlets? Can anyone please tell me the use cases of multiple Dispatcher Servlets. I think every use case can be solved by using single Dispatcher Servlet.


Strictly seperating user and admin functionality. Or one for plain Spring MVC and another for Spring Web Flow. If there are major configuration differences for some controllers. (We actually used the Spring MVC and Spring Web Flow seperation so that we could add this without affecting the already exising configs). Nowadays with servlet 3.0 you could develop seperate parts of your application seperatly and have all of them contribute there own DispatcherServlet and mappings (although you could also achieve this with some configuration conventions).


  • Resize and scale HTML5 Canvas and contents
  • Clean up PHP/HTML pages
  • JFrame attached on the side of another JFrame
  • PHP function error and success pattern
  • Getting wrong values for other columns when I select MAX(updated_date)
  • Trying to get mvc resources to serve my static resources
  • MVC - Dynamically loading Partial Views
  • Rewrite part of javascript with C#
  • Routing in WCF data services
  • Grails/Roo for a .Net developer
  • Mod rewrite redirection to another domain if file not exist
  • How to bind comma separated list of values to List
  • Why is django manage.py syncdb failing to create new columns on my development server?
  • Configuring multiple DefaultJmslistenercontainerfactory
  • How can I let users share their location in Bot Framework webchat channel?
  • Streaming screenshots over WebRTC as a video stream from iOS
  • Changing Jupyter Notebook start up folder by modifying “start in” not working any more
  • Runtime.exec() gives Error: Could not find or load main class
  • Configure nginx to return different files to different authenticated users with the same URI
  • Mixing WebForms and MVC: What should I do with the MasterPage?
  • HttpURLConnection Closing IO Streams
  • How to 'create temp table as select' in Slick?
  • How to override value that appears in a dropdown in the rails_admin gem
  • hide missing dates from x-axis ggplot2
  • quiver not drawing arrows just lots of blue, matlab
  • JPA flush vs commit
  • as3-flash: any way to access all the instances placed in different frames from document class?
  • What is the purpose of TaskExecutor in spring?
  • Parsing a CSV string while ignoring commas inside the individual columns
  • Webgrid not refreshing after delete MVC
  • How to use carriage return with multiple line?
  • MVC3 Razor - ListBox pre-select not working
  • Cancel a live stream “fast motion” catch-up in Flash
  • FB SDK and cURL: Unknown SSL protocol error in connection to graph.facebook.com:443
  • QLineEdit password safety
  • Is there a mandatory requirement to switch app.yaml?
  • Busy indicator not showing up in wpf window [duplicate]
  • UserPrincipal.Current returns apppool on IIS
  • Python/Django TangoWithDjango Models and Databases
  • Net Present Value in Excel for Grouped Recurring CF